Now recruiting for a Sales & Events Coordinator at No.1 York, by GuestHouse.
Do you have a knack for planning events? Can you sell a venue with the same enthusiasm you’d reserve for a perfectly poured pint? Are you ready to work in a city where history meets hospitality — and every booking tells a story?
Here at the No.1 York, by GuestHouse we’re a small but stylish, family-run boutique hotel, and we’re looking for a Sales & Events Coordinator, who can turn enquiries into experiences, and ideas into unforgettable moments.
What You’ll Be Doing
- Handling event enquiries with charm, speed, and precision
- Coordinating weddings, meetings, private dinners, and everything in between
- Building strong relationships with clients, suppliers, and internal teams
- Managing bookings, contracts, and all the little details that make big days run smoothly
- Supporting the wider Commercial team with creative ideas and proactive outreach

What We’re Looking For
- Organised, enthusiastic, and great with people
- Experienced in events coordination or hospitality sales (or both!) bonus points if you’re from a luxury background.
- A natural communicator with an eye for detail and a flair for planning
- Ready to bring warmth, wit, and a touch of York magic to every occasion
- Knowledge of Opera Cloud (OSEM) would be really useful too!
